Cumberland Road is in London and in Enfield district. N9 8NA is located in the Lower Edmonton elect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Edmonton.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ding N9 8NA has a female population much higher than UK average, with 58.2% of the population being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around N9 8NA,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 46.8%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Safety

Is Cumberland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Cumberland Road was 207.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 97.9% higher than the Jubilee average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Cumberland Road has the 11th highest crime rate of 75 local areas in Jubilee and the 104th highest crime rate of 823 local areas in Enfield .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 49.3 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-6.1%.
